Lines Matching refs:MOVBE
3 …c < %s -mtriple=i686-unknown -mattr=+movbe | FileCheck %s --check-prefix=CHECK --check-prefix=MOVBE
51 ; MOVBE-LABEL: load_i32_by_i8_bswap:
52 ; MOVBE: # %bb.0:
53 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
54 ; MOVBE-NEXT: movbel (%eax), %eax
55 ; MOVBE-NEXT: retl
190 ; MOVBE-LABEL: load_i32_by_i16_by_i8_bswap:
191 ; MOVBE: # %bb.0:
192 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
193 ; MOVBE-NEXT: movbel (%eax), %eax
194 ; MOVBE-NEXT: retl
296 ; MOVBE-LABEL: load_i64_by_i8_bswap:
297 ; MOVBE: # %bb.0:
298 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%ecx
299 ; MOVBE-NEXT: movbel 4(%ecx), %eax
300 ; MOVBE-NEXT: movbel (%ecx), %edx
301 ; MOVBE-NEXT: retl
676 ; MOVBE-LABEL: load_i32_by_i8_nonzero_offset_bswap:
677 ; MOVBE: # %bb.0:
678 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
679 ; MOVBE-NEXT: movbel 1(%eax), %eax
680 ; MOVBE-NEXT: retl
724 ; MOVBE-LABEL: load_i32_by_i8_neg_offset_bswap:
725 ; MOVBE: # %bb.0:
726 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
727 ; MOVBE-NEXT: movbel -4(%eax), %eax
728 ; MOVBE-NEXT: retl
773 ; MOVBE-LABEL: load_i32_by_i8_bswap_base_index_offset:
774 ; MOVBE: # %bb.0:
775 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
776 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%ecx
777 ; MOVBE-NEXT: movbel (%ecx,%eax), %eax
778 ; MOVBE-NEXT: retl
857 ; MOVBE-LABEL: load_i32_by_bswap_i16:
858 ; MOVBE: # %bb.0:
859 ; MOVBE-NEXT: movl {{[0-9]+}}(%esp), %eax
860 ; MOVBE-NEXT: movbel (%eax), %eax
861 ; MOVBE-NEXT: retl